Effects of Untreated Missing Out On Teeth
Beyond the visible gap, without treatment missing out on teeth can have extensive effects. These include the moving of adjacent teeth, wear and tear of jawbone density, and the possible influence on speech and chewing function.
Insight: The effects of unattended missing out on teeth extend beyond looks. Surgical Placement of the Implant
A precise surgical procedure follows, throughout which the implant is safely placed into the jawbone. This stage sets the structure for the implant's combination with the natural bone-- a process known as osseointegration.
Insight: The surgical placement needs precision and competence. Comprehending the complexities of this phase provides clients with confidence in the dependability of the implant placement.

Long-lasting Dangers and Preventive Measures
Understanding long-lasting threats, such as peri-implantitis or bone loss, empowers patients to take preventive measures. Regular follow-ups and adherence to oral health guidelines alleviate these dangers.

Is it regular for teeth to move with age?
To some extent, yes. Natural shifts in tooth alignment can happen due to changes in jawbone density. If substantial shifting is observed, consulting with an orthodontist is suggested for proper evaluation and potential intervention.
How does aging impact the look of teeth?
Aging can lead to changes in tooth color, shape, and size. Cosmetic dentistry provides services, consisting of veneers and teeth whitening, to attend to these concerns and improve the total look of the smile.
Can older grownups get braces?
While braces are less typical for senior citizens, alternative orthodontic choices like clear aligners may appropriate. A assessment with an orthodontic professional can identify the expediency of treatment based on specific needs.
What function does saliva play in oral health as we age?
Saliva plays a important role in preserving oral health by neutralizing acids, aiding in digestion, and preventing dry mouth. Elders experiencing dry mouth can check out artificial saliva items and ensure sufficient hydration.
Are oral implants a ideal choice for seniors?
Yes, dental implants can be a feasible choice for elders with great overall health. However, individual assessments are needed to determine suitability, considering elements like bone density and general oral health.
